This month's feature release for The Revolution, nominated by me (Shadowdoom9 (Andi)), is the 2003 sophomore album by North Carolina-based melodic metalcore band Undying, At History's End. Not much I can say in this shorter summary except an underground classic that should be heard by the metalcore masses!

Here's my review summary:

Metalcore bands like Undying have really touched the hearts of people who were around my age (mid-20s) or younger back then. As always, Undying provide their melodic metalcore sound that was only in the early stages of popularity. There are some things different in At History's End compared to the previous album. More direct melodies, more hardcore riffs, and more poetic lyrics, the latter recited by female vocalist Logan White, replacing Timothy Roy. You gotta admire Logan's lyrical spirit! At History's End really should've had as much love and recognition as the more mainstream bands out there. Still it's fine staying underground. Now that the band has reformed recently, they now have time to create a new part of their melodic metalcore evolution and maybe hit that perfect 5-star mark. Their history shall be ongoing!

4.5/5

Recommended tracks: "Reckoning", "As Above", "For the Dying", "The Age of Grace"

For fans of: Allegiance-era As Blood Runs Black, early Killswitch Engage, Prayer for Cleansing
